768 million people in the world do not have safe drinking water available to them. More than 3.4 million people die each year from water, sanitation, and hygiene related causes. Water can cause many of these problems since they do not have access to safe water.

Water Problems the US faces:
In the United States there are droughts in the south west of the country. This crisis could spread to other places in the country when resources cannot replenish the growing demand.

Problems with safe drinking water is a problem for over 1 billion people.Over 2,000 children die everyday from diarrhea that is caused by contaminated drinking water. More children die from diarrheal illnesses than from HIV/AIDS and malaria combined.
